Doña Ana County, located in New Mexico, has a population of 229,150 with a population density of 60.1 people per square mile. The county has a diverse population, with 67.6% White, 1.6% Black, 1.4% American Indian and Alaska Native, 1% Asian, and 15.7% Hispanic. The median age in Doña Ana County is 32.5 years, with a slightly higher percentage of females (46.5%) compared to males (44.8%). The county has a total of 75,532 households, with an average household size of 2.71 and a majority of households being family households (68.5%).
In comparison to other counties in New Mexico, Doña Ana County stands out for its larger population size, higher population density, and diverse demographic composition. The county has a higher percentage of Hispanic residents compared to the state average of 48.5%. Additionally, Doña Ana County has a higher median age than the state average of 37.3 years. The county also has a higher proportion of family households and a slightly higher average household size compared to the state average. In terms of agricultural land, Doña Ana County has a significant number of farms (1,946) and a total crop acreage of 93,128 acres, with an average sales value of $190,284 per farm, indicating a strong agricultural presence in the county.
